Crime overview

Burns Avenue area has the 25th highest crime rate of 71 local areas in Bushbury North , and the 390th lowest crime rate of 782 local areas in Wolverhampton .

At least one of the neighbouring streets has high or very high crime levels. However, overall crime around this postcode is more mixed, with some nearby areas experiencing lower crime.

The overall crime rate in the area around Burns Avenue (WV10 6BH) in the last 12 months was 64.9 per 1,000 residents and was 16.7% lower than the Bushbury North average (77.9 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Violence and sexual offences with 18 offences recorded. The least common crime was Anti-social behaviour with 1 case , unchanged from 2025. The fastest-growing crime category was Drugs ( 200.0% YoY). Other major crime categories were broadly unchanged compared to 2025.

Violent crimes totalled 19 (≈ 45.7 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were flat ( 0.0%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-60.2% comparing early vs recent averages) .

In the area around Burns Avenue (WV10 6BH), the main crime hotspot is near Three Tuns Parade. Police recorded 22 crimes here, including 18 violent or public-order offences. All these locations are within roughly 0.3 miles.
